Last update: 11 hours agoHeatwave toll: Europe logged over 10,000 excess deaths in late-June as extreme heat pushed temperatures past 40°C in parts of Germany, France and Spain, with most deaths among people 65+. Wildfire crisis near Paris: A “very virulent” blaze in the Fontainebleau forest burned about 800 hectares, partially closing the A6 and disrupting rail; around 900 homes were evacuated and officials suspect possible arson. France’s nuclear strain: France temporarily shut three nuclear reactors as the heatwave intensified, underscoring how climate stress is hitting energy security. Urban cooling push: Paris and other cities are planting Miyawaki micro-forests to cool neighborhoods and boost biodiversity. Energy geopolitics: Europe bought a record 9.89m tonnes of Russian Yamal LNG in H1 2026 ahead of an EU import ban, with France the biggest buyer. Tech for climate resilience: A French startup is deploying inflatable fixed-wing drones for pipeline inspections, aiming to reduce the risk of environmental disasters. Biodiversity & nature rights: A Scottish marine science group added “the ocean” to its board, giving ecosystems a formal voice in decisions.
